当前位置: > 投稿>正文

linux查看所有磁盘,查看磁盘大小(如何找出最占硬盘空间的10个目录或文件)

03-02 互联网 未知 投稿

关于【linux查看所有磁盘】,查看磁盘大小,今天乾乾小编给您分享一下,如果对您有所帮助别忘了关注本站哦。

1、Linux 如何找出最占硬盘空间的10个目录或文件

如何找出最占硬盘空间的10个目录或文件

方法1

bash -c 'du -ah / | sort -hr | head -n 10' 2>/dev/nulldu -ah / 2>/dev/null | sort -hr | head -n 10

方法2

bash -c 'find / -print0 | xargs -0 du -h | sort -hr | uniq | head -n 10' 2>/dev/null

方法3

bash -c 'find / -exec du -h {} + | sort -hr | uniq | head -n 10' 2>/dev/null

linux查看所有磁盘,查看磁盘大小(如何找出最占硬盘空间的10个目录或文件)

找出最占硬盘空间的10个目录或文件的三个方法

如何找出最占硬盘空间的10个目录

方法1

bash -c 'du -h / | sort -hr | head -n 10' 2>/dev/null

方法2

bash -c 'find / -type d -print0 | xargs -0 du -h | sort -hr | uniq | head -n 10' 2>/dev/null

方法3

bash -c 'find / -type d -exec du -h {} + | sort -hr | uniq | head -n 10' 2>/dev/null

linux查看所有磁盘,查看磁盘大小(如何找出最占硬盘空间的10个目录或文件)

找出最占硬盘空间的10个目录的三个方法

如何找出最占硬盘空间的10个文件

方法1

bash -c 'find / -type f -print0 | xargs -0 du -h | sort -hr | head -n 10' 2>/dev/nullbash -c 'find / -type f -size +90M -print0 | xargs -0 du -h | sort -hr | head -n 10' 2>/dev/null

方法2

bash -c 'find / -type f -exec du -h {} + | sort -hr | head -n 10' 2>/dev/nullbash -c 'find / -type f -size +90M -exec du -h {} + | sort -hr | head -n 10' 2>/dev/null

linux查看所有磁盘,查看磁盘大小(如何找出最占硬盘空间的10个目录或文件)

找出最占硬盘空间的10个文件的两个方法

du命令的使用场景

估算某个目录、该目录下的所有子目录各自占用多少硬盘空间(不含该目录下的子文件)

# 不加-a,说明只估算所有子目录,不估算所有子文件bash -c 'du -h / | sort -hr | head -n 50' 2>/dev/null

估算某个目录、该目录下的所有子目录、该目录下的所有子文件各自占用多少硬盘空间

# 加了-a,说明除了估算所有子目录之外,还要估算所有子文件bash -c 'du -ah / | sort -hr | head -n 50' 2>/dev/null

估算一个目录占用多少硬盘空间(不含该目录下的所有子目录和子文件)

root@hgdm:~# du -sh / 2>/dev/null8.5G/

估算一个目录下的所有一级子目录、所有一级子文件各自占用多少硬盘空间

root@hgdm:~# du -sh /* 2>/dev/null | sort -hr4.0G/var3.0G/usr948M/swapfile381M/data138M/boot104M/root6.5M/etc2.6M/home692K/run64K/tmp16K/lost+found12K/media4.0K/srv4.0K/opt4.0K/mnt0/sys0/sbin0/proc0/libx320/lib640/lib320/lib0/dev0/bin

估算一个文件占用多少硬盘空间

root@hgdm:~# du -h /var/log/nginx/access.log48K/var/log/nginx/access.log

估算多个文件各自占用多少硬盘空间

root@hgdm:~# du -h /var/log/nginx/access.log /root/examples/data111.txt48K/var/log/nginx/access.log4.0K/root/examples/data111.txt

du命令的常用命令选项

  • -a:加-a则输出结果=某个目录 + 子目录 + 子文件(含子文件)不加-a则输出结果 = 某个目录 + 子目录(不含子文件)
  • -s: 英文单词是summary或simple,意思是,加-s则输出结果既不含子目录也不含子文件。
  • -h: 英文单词是human-readable,指以人类可读的方式输出结果,单位为T、G、M、K。

需要注意的问题1

当使用du -sh命令估算两个或两个以上的目录的空间使用情况时,当这些待估算目录存在隶属关系或父子关系时,不会得到想到的结果

示例命令执行结果如下:

2、linux查看所有磁盘:linux 查看磁盘大小

linux 查看磁盘大小

linux中df命令的功能是用来检查linux服务器的文件系统的磁盘空间占用情况。可以利用该命令来获取硬盘被占用了多少空间,目前还剩下多少空间等信息。

如果没有文件名被指定,则所有当前被挂载的文件系统的可用空间将被显示。默认情况下,磁盘空间将以1KB为单位进行显示,除非环境变量POSIXLY_CORRECT 被指定,那样将以512字节为单位进行显示。

linux查看磁盘空间 都有哪些命令

打开linux系统,在linux的桌面的空白处右击。在弹出的下拉选项里,点击打开终端。

LINUX操作系统是一种免费使用和自由传播的类UNIX操作系统。其内核由林纳斯·托瓦兹于1991年10月5日首次发布,是一个基于POSI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的Unix工具软件、应用程序和网络协议,是一个性能稳定的多用户网络操作系统。在图形计算中,一个桌面环境(Desktop environment,有时称为桌面管理器)为计算机提供一个图形用户界面(GUI)。

但严格来说窗口管理器和桌面环境是有区别的。桌面环境就是桌面图形环境,它的主要目标是为Linux/Unix操作系统提供一个更加完备 的界面以及大量各类整合工具和使用 程序,其基本 易用性吸引着大量的新用户。桌面环境名称来自桌面比拟,对应于早期的文字命令行界面(CLI)。

一个典型的桌面环境提供图标,视窗,工具栏,文件夹,壁纸以及像拖放这样的能力。整体而言,桌面环境在设计和功能上的特性,赋予了它与众不同的外观和感觉。

linux中怎么查硬盘大小

你可以通过如下命令来进行查看:Linux查看磁盘空间大小命令df -hldf -hl 查看磁盘剩余空间df -h 查看每个根路径的分区大小du -sh [目录名] 返回该目录的大小du -sm [文件夹] 返回该文件夹总M数du -h [目录名] 查看指定文件夹下的所有文件大小(包含子文件夹)更新详细命令文档:df --helpdu --help查看硬盘的分区:fdisk -l查看IDE硬盘信息:hdparm -i /dev/hda查看STAT硬盘信息:hdparm -I /dev/sda 或 apt-get install blktool 或 blktool /dev/sda id查看目录占用空间:du -hs 目录名以上就是相关命令,希望能帮到你。

本文关键词:linux系统安装,linux查看cpu信息,linux查看磁盘空间 命令,linux培训班,linux属于什么操作系统。这就是关于《linux查看所有磁盘,查看磁盘大小(如何找出最占硬盘空间的10个目录或文件)》的所有内容,希望对您能有所帮助!更多的知识请继续关注《犇涌向乾》百科知识网站:http://www.029ztxx.com!

版权声明: 本站仅提供信息存储空间服务,旨在传递更多信息,不拥有所有权,不承担相关法律责任,不代表本网赞同其观点和对其真实性负责。如因作品内容、版权和其它问题需要同本网联系的,请发送邮件至 举报,一经查实,本站将立刻删除。

猜你喜欢